Course Description:

When can I fully return to my activity? A simple question that has such a complex
answer. Could you imagine knowing how to make the return to activity decision confidently and
concretely, so the patient, parent and physician all agree? There are so many opinions, emotions,
and variables that go into return to sport and discharge that the experience seems anything but
certain. Yet, it does not have to be so confusing. There is a process. There is objective data we
can look at to remove the confusion, the uncertainty, and the indecision. Evidenced-based tests
exist to identify these risk factors and improve your confidence when making return to sport and
discharge decisions. This course seeks to systemize these decisions by using the latest research
and the results of a 10-year, multi-million-dollar research process in injury prediction and return
to activity. You can dramatically impact your patient’s health and reduce re-injury rates by
making evidence-based, discharge and return to sport decisions. There is no guesswork, there is
a data-driven decision. This course will lay the foundation to help you develop a scientific
decision-making process, select evidence-based tests, and apply them to patient care. This course
is for physical therapists, athletic trainers, and occupational therapists.
